I just want to see the Packers fully utilize Ty like they were doing for stretches of the last couple seasons. Call your play, audible depending on what the defense is showing. If they're in dime and Ty is outside, bring him into the backfield and either pound it up the gut or play action. If they're playing run, move him outside and pass. He's a mismatch on the ground against DBs and through the air against LBs. There's plenty of opportunity to exploit those mismatches. Then when the defense starts keying in on Montgomery - start mixing it up with Williams who is a good back in his own right.

I don't think it's an issue of not being able to figure it out so much as McCarthy being really big on trying to set the tone for a game, and that's a big part of how he gets teams ready for a team during the week. Unfortunately we don't seem to have regular success running the football until we've had success through the air, so in a lot of ways we're not a conventional team. If we were getting 3-5 yards a carry running it up the gut, McCarthy would be a genius and it would take all kinds of pressure off Rodgers and the O-Line. We're just not getting it done in the early game though and haven't done so consistently in some time.
